Microsoft Halts 'Tokenmaxxing' With Strict Budget Caps; GPT-5.6 Becomes Internal Default

Chinese tech outlet QbitAI reports that Microsoft has halted "Tokenmaxxing" internally — the practice of pushing token usage to its absolute limit — and locked down AI budgets.
According to the report, usage beyond the budget cap is now at employees' own risk, meaning internal teams can no longer burn tokens without restraint.
The report adds that GPT-5.6 is now Microsoft's default internal model for everyday AI work.
Token consumption is becoming the biggest variable in enterprise AI spending, with long-context and agent-driven tasks rapidly inflating the cost of a single run.
As a major OpenAI investor and one of the world's largest cloud providers, Microsoft's internal cost discipline is often read as a signal for AI spending across the industry.
For developers, hard budget caps mean prompt design, context length, and agent call counts now need careful planning.
The next question is whether Microsoft ships finer-grained quota management tools, and whether other tech giants follow with similar limits.

Sand.ai Open-Sources What It Calls the First 100B-Parameter MoE Video Generation Model
Sand.ai has open-sourced a Mixture-of-Experts video generation model it bills as the world's first 100-billion-parameter MoE video model, with 114B total parameters and just 6B active. The model generates 10-second 1080p clips at a reported cost of about 0.5 yuan each, sharply lowering the cost barrier for high-quality AI video.

ByteDance Seed Unveils SeedRealtime: Full-Duplex Audio-Video Model Debuts in Doubao
ByteDance's Seed team has released SeedRealtime, a full-duplex audio-video large model now integrated into the Doubao app. The model lets users watch, listen, and speak simultaneously, removing the awkward pauses of turn-based voice assistants and pushing real-time multimodal interaction into a mainstream consumer product.
